Style Breakdown
Mythical & Legendary
- Best for: Fantasy enthusiasts who want to invoke epic tales.
- Examples:
- “Ethereal Warriors”
- “Divine Sentinels”
- “Titan’s Wrath”
- “Celestial Guardians”
- “Phoenix Reborn”
- “Arcane Knights”
- “Fabled Champions”
- “Seraphic Legion”
- Pros:
- Evokes a sense of grandeur and adventure.
- Can attract players who love lore and storytelling.
- Cons:
- Might come off as cliché if overused.
Punny & Humorous
- Best for: Light-hearted gamers who enjoy a good laugh.
- Examples:
- “Dota-saurus Rex”
- “The Dota-tastic Four”
- “Wards of the Lost Ark”
- “Rage Against the Dying of the Light”
- “Dota-nado”
- “Creep It Real”
- “Minesweeper Squad”
- “The Dire-rectors”
- Pros:
- Adds a fun, approachable vibe to your team.
- Memorable and likely to get laughs from opponents.
- Cons:
- Might not be taken as seriously in competitive circles.
Dark & Edgy
- Best for: Competitive players who want to intimidate their opponents.
- Examples:
- “Shadow Reapers”
- “Dark Ascendancy”
- “Vortex of Despair”
- “Dreadnought Legion”
- “The Abyssal Blades”
- “Sinister Shadows”
- “Nightmare Collective”
- “The Forgotten Ones”
- Pros:
- Creates an intimidating presence.
- Appeals to those who prefer a darker aesthetic.
- Cons:
- May alienate players who prefer a lighter atmosphere.
Pop Culture Inspired
- Best for: Trendy gamers looking to resonate with current events or franchises.
- Examples:
- “The Dota Avengers”
- “Guardians of the Dota”
- “Dota and Chill”
- “Game of Throws”
- “Dota-lympians”
- “Breaking Dota”
- “Dota Wars: The Clone Wars”
- “The Walking Dota”
- Pros:
- Engages with contemporary references, making the name relatable.
- Can attract fans of the referenced media.
- Cons:
- May become outdated quickly as trends shift.
Which Style Should YOU Choose?
Choosing the right style depends on your team's personality and approach to the game. If you value storytelling and depth, go with a Mythical & Legendary name. For a more light-hearted approach, Punny & Humorous is perfect. If your squad thrives on competition and intimidation, lean into Dark & Edgy. And if you want to stay trendy and relevant, Pop Culture Inspired names are your best bet.

Tips for 2026: Combining Styles
- Mix & Match: Combine elements from different styles to create something unique, like “Ethereal Dota-nado.”
- Use Alliteration: Names like “Dreadnought Dota” can be catchy and memorable.
- Stay Relevant: Keep an eye on trends and popular culture to incorporate fresh references into your name.
